Troubleshooting & Replacement Tips

After ten years of crawling inside robot cells at 2 AM, here’s what actually goes wrong with the IRB1200 axis motor — and what you need to know before you crack open the arm:

Common Fault Codes Pointing to 3HAC044514-001 Failure:

  • ERR_AXIS_OVERLOAD (50071) — Motor current exceeds rated threshold. First check for mechanical binding in the gearbox. If the gearbox is clear, the motor winding is degraded. Replace the motor.
  • ERR_MOTOR_TEMP (50024) — Thermal sensor inside the motor housing is reading over-temperature. If ambient is within spec and cooling airflow is unobstructed, the sensor or motor itself is failing.
  • ERR_RESOLVER_FAULT (50052) — Resolver signal loss or corruption. Check the resolver cable connector at the motor first — vibration loosens the locking ring. If the connector is seated and the cable tests clean, the resolver inside the motor is gone. Motor replacement required.
  • ERR_JOINT_SPEED (50060) — Unexpected velocity spike on the axis. Often caused by encoder/resolver feedback corruption during motor degradation. Do not ignore this fault — it can trigger a safety stop cascade across all axes.

Replacement Procedure — Key Steps:

  • Before removal: run a Calibration Offset backup from the FlexPendant (Calibration → Fine Calibration → Store). You will need this to restore axis zero after the swap.
  • De-energize the controller and wait the full 5-minute DC bus discharge period. The IRB1200 capacitor bank will bite you if you skip this.
  • The 3HAC044514-001 pinion is factory-pressed and timed. Do not attempt to remove or re-press the pinion in the field — order the complete assembly.
  • Torque the motor mounting bolts to ABB spec (refer to IRB1200 Product Manual, section 4.3). Under-torquing causes micro-movement that destroys the pinion mesh within weeks.
  • After installation: run the Fine Calibration routine using the stored offset values. Verify axis zero position with a calibration pin before releasing the robot to production.
  • No firmware flashing required — the IRC5 and OmniCore C30 auto-detect the motor parameters on first power-up.

Reliability in Harsh Conditions

The IRB1200 is deployed in environments that would kill consumer-grade hardware in a week — electronics assembly cleanrooms with electrostatic discharge risks, food processing lines with daily washdowns, and automotive sub-assembly cells where coolant mist is a constant. The 3HAC044514-001 is built to survive all of it.

  • Vibration resistance: The motor housing and resolver assembly are rated to IEC 60068-2-6 vibration profiles. The factory-integrated pinion eliminates the separate coupling that is the first failure point in field-assembled alternatives.
  • Thermal tolerance: Continuous operation across the full IRB1200 ambient range (5°C to 45°C) with thermal protection class F windings. The internal thermal sensor provides early warning before winding damage occurs.
  • Ingress protection: Sealed to IP54 as part of the IRB1200 arm assembly. The motor connector uses a positive-locking bayonet design that resists vibration-induced disconnection — a known failure mode on older ABB platforms.
  • EMC shielding: Resolver cable shielding is bonded at the motor end to suppress encoder noise in high-frequency drive environments. This matters in cells running multiple servo axes simultaneously.
